
The Sundance Institute is thrilled to resume the Accessible Futures Initiative in 2021 as a virtual intensive. Created in 2019, the intensive is part of the Sundance Institute's ongoing commitment to deepening outreach to and support of artists with disabilities, including amplifying accessibility at the Sundance Film Festival with guidance and support of our partners at Easterseals Southern California and implementing all-staff accessibility inclusion trainings provided by RespectAbility. The 2021 Intensive will take the shape of a cross-genre project consultation and career strategy workshop for artists of color, with disabilities, in the development or early production of fiction and nonfiction projects.
We are so excited to bring together this powerful group of artists, creative advisors, and organizational collaborators! While we still have much work ahead to advance disability justice, the Outreach & Inclusion program is committed to bringing an intersectional lens to the work that we do and humbled by the long legacy of disabled artists.
The Sundance Institute collaborated with Allied Organizations with deep relationships within the disability community to nominate applicants and to function as advisors. Additionally, Sundance staff, artist alumni and field leading partners will conduct creative and professional development sessions, to support the advancement of the selected participants' projects and careers. Through this multi-day virtual Intensive, we seek to assist participating artists in honing their creative voice and craft, finding a cohort, and building support for them to help surmount critical barriers in the field that has systematically excluded artists with disabilities.
The advisors for the 2021 Intensive include Day Al-Mohamed, Rodney Evans, Josh Feldman, Tatiana Lee, Monika Navarro, and Nic Novicki. We are excited to collaborate with Sins Invalid and Firelight Media who will lead community building and documentary workshops for the artists, respectively. Thank you to Easterseals Disability Services and Rev.com for supporting our accessibility and inclusion initiatives.
NASREEN ALKHATEEB (Director)Award-winning filmmaker Nasreen Alkhateeb's ability to motivate audiences is a result of being first-gen, multi-heritage, Disabled, and a survivor. Cinematographer for Kamala Harris and Oprahs OWN Network, Nasreen has directed content for NASA, the United Nations, and the Women's March. Alumna of the Tribeca Film Festival, the Disruptors Fellowship, the RespectAbility Fellowship, and given the Wild Card award by NASA peers and Cinematographer of the Year for her work in the Arctic, Forbes described her as breaking barriers.
Touching Fire: In an age when a Muslim feminist icon can have their entire life's work undone by the click of a tweet, a daughter dives deep into her mother's legacy to set the record straight.
VIRTIC EMIL BROWN (Writer, Director)Virtic Emil Brown attended New York Universitys Tisch School of the Arts. She is a writer, actress, and filmmaker. Some of her films are Will Unplugged, Mission In Kosovo, and Hindsight. Virtic's directorial debut was the documentary short On Tour, which screened at the 70th Venice International Film Festival. She's appeared on shows like Without A Trace and The Shield. She is a member of the Classical Theatre Lab and EST/LA. Virtic is in WGA (CBW, DWC, CWW).
Free!: In the final six days of their childs life, the Bradys must confront their past. This is not the life God wanted for them when He gave their souls a body.
SHAINA GHURAYA (Writer, Director)Shaina jokes that she is a triple threat: She's a wheelchair-user, Punjabi, and a woman. She is a writer-director for quirky and bold comedies that embrace diversity and explore intersectionality. A graduate of USCs Film and Television production program, Shainas films have gone on to screen at ReelAbilities, Hollyshorts, and Slamdance. Currently, she is a writing apprentice on the Netflix Animation show Boons and Curses.
Agg: A conservative (psychotic) Indian family decides to trick a man into an arranged marriage by hiding their daughter's disability. However, the daughter, Agg, decides the wedding is the perfect time to enact violent (yet still tasteful) revenge against her abusive family.
Cashmere Jasmine (Writer, Director)Cashmere Jasmine is an award-winning first-generation disabled Afro-Caribbean writer and director from South Florida who creates queer, disability-inclusive dramas accented by dark humor and surrealist imagery in between jaunts of loudly drinking cocktails in dark L.A. bars with her ever-faithful sidekick Greyfriars Bobby the Little (always pictured).
Bitter: After losing custody of her little sister, a homeless dialysis patient climbs the social and financial ladder by manipulating the L.A. underground party scene in this hour-long Breaking Bad-meets-Ally McBeal dramedy.
LUNA X MOYA (Director, Editor, DP)Luna X Moya (they/she) is a documentary filmmaker with over 10 years of experience, primarily as a director and editor, in the film and television industry. Their work screened at A+E Networks, MoMA, The Shed, BAMcinemaFest, and AFI SilverDocs. Luna is a formerly undocumented, queer, and chronically ill filmmaker. She focuses on documentary films about immigration, racial injustice, estranged family dynamics, and desire.
What the Pier Gave Us: A five-part poetic and experimental film about immigrants who fish at a pier in New York and the immigrant experience. What The Pier Gave Us lyrically captures the life of a pier through the seasons in a year.
